Darrin W. Anderson, Sr. PhD
Dr. Darrin W. Anderson, Sr. is a seasoned nonprofit executive and population health leader with more than 25 years of experience advancing health equity, economic mobility, and community‑driven systems change across the Mid‑Atlantic region. He currently serves as President and Chief Executive Officer of the Urban League of Greater Philadelphia, where he leads strategic initiatives focused on dismantling systemic barriers and expanding access to education, workforce development, housing, entrepreneurship, and health equity services for historically underserved communities.
Previously, Dr. Anderson served as Chief Executive Officer of the New Jersey YMCA State Alliance, overseeing a statewide network of 31 associations, managing $300 million in revenue, and supporting more than 11,500 employees. During his tenure, he built a $5 million annual portfolio of health equity initiatives, secured over $50 million in public funding during the COVID‑19 pandemic, and partnered with national organizations including the Robert Wood Johnson Foundation, CDC, Sanofi, and Novo Nordisk. Earlier in his career, Dr. Anderson held senior leadership roles with the American Diabetes Association and the American Heart Association, where he led multimillion‑dollar fundraising, public policy, and community health initiatives.
Dr. Anderson holds a PhD in Kinesiology and Applied Exercise Physiology (Population Health) from Temple University, a Master of Science in Health and Exercise Science from the University of Delaware, and a Bachelor of Science in Health and Physical Education. He has also served as adjunct faculty at institutions including Rowan University and Springfield College and is a widely recognized speaker on health equity, leadership, and economic mobility.
In addition to his role with Community Council Health Systems, Dr. Anderson serves on several boards and advisory committees, including the Committee of Seventy and the New Jersey Department of Health Preventive Health Advisory Committee.
